3. Make Modern Updates for an Immediate Draw

One of the easiest and not-utilized-enough ways to draw new tenants to your properties is to make modern updates. This one single change can make an immediate draw to buyers. If your space looks new and luxe, they are going to pay more money for the space and are more inclined to think your price is worth what you ask for.

Some of the best ways to modernize your rental properties include:

  • Update common areas for better first impressions
  • Refresh amenities and swap for updated appliances, counters, flooring, etc.
  • Install new tech (keyless entry, security systems, smart thermostats, etc.)
  • Enhance natural light and add mood lighting
  • Reconfigure the layout for more open floor plans and enhanced space
  • Refresh bathrooms with new lighting fixtures, mirrors, better lighting, and new tile
  • Add energy-saving upgrades (new windows, LED lighting, upgraded plumbing, etc.)
  • Paint with neutral, modern colors and replace trim, handles, and fixtures to match
  • Coordinate color schemes across the building and add accent walls for a unique look

While these updates might require an initial investment, they give you money back quickly since tenants will pay more per month. On top of that, the quality of renters will only go up as you enhance the quality of your space and increase prices to match. Overall, these modern updates equate to more money back in your own pocket.
